## Changelog — Quellstack 4.2

Changed defaults for the alert deduplicator. The grouping window was widened and fingerprinting now includes the escalation tier, which reduced duplicate pages by roughly a third in our trials. Existing overrides are preserved; only unset keys pick up the new behavior. If you maintain a tenant config, compare it against the new baseline. The updated default values are as follows:

settings of fafog-haduf:
ZORIX_PIN=4648
ZORIX_METRICS_HOST=metrics.zorix.paliqsys.corp
ZORIX_LOG_LEVEL=info
ZORIX_TENANT=druix

## Changelog — v4.2.1 (Key Rotation)

Rotated the signing key used by the Ledgerbird admin console after the bulk-edit feature shipped. Bulk edits to the accounts table now require signed requests, so older clients must upgrade. As a new contractor, update your local config before testing bulk operations against staging. The newly issued signing key is as follows.

rollout seal: bky4_x7Gc

## Build Provenance: ChipGate Reader Firmware

The ChipGate timing-chip reader, deployed at the Varnholt Marathon series, ships firmware built exclusively on the sealed Brenner pipeline. Each build pulls pinned dependencies from the internal Loxfield mirror; no network fetches occur at compile time. Artifacts are signed by the release robot and cross-checked against the reproducibility harness before field flashing. Reviewers should confirm the manifest hash matches the attestation record. The token for the current firmware build appears below.

session token of tajef-bageg = htk21_5d90d574934f3ccae6437

If the Parcelwing webhook dispatcher stops delivering parcel-status events and normal admin access is unavailable, use the break-glass procedure. Page the secondary on-call first; if no response in ten minutes, proceed alone. Log your reason in the incident channel before acting. The break-glass account bypasses SSO and grants direct access to the dispatcher console, including replay controls for missed events. Access expires after one hour and is audited. The console prompts for the recovery passphrase shown below.

unlock words, hahip-baduf: holwyn-istath-julvan